Kerch vs Tripoli, Peloponnese Climate & Distance Between

Greece flag
  • The distance between Kerch, Russia and Tripoli, Peloponnese, Greece is approximately 1,456 km or 905 mi.
  • To reach Kerch in this distance one would set out from Tripoli, Peloponnese bearing 48.7°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kerch bearing 58° or ENE .
  • Kerch has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Tripoli, Peloponnese has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
  • Kerch is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Tripoli, Peloponnese is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 2.9 °C (5.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.7 °C (4.9°F) more in Kerch.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 376.7 mm (14.8 in) less which is equivalent to 376.7 l/m² (9.25 US gal/ft²) or 3,767,000 l/ha (402,717 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7.9° lower in Kerch than in Tripoli, Peloponnese.
